Commit ac654330 authored by Jiří Klimeš's avatar Jiří Klimeš
Browse files

config: fix a crash in nm_config_device_get_hwaddr()

get_hw_address (nm_device_get_hw_address()) asserts and then SIGSEGV
happens in nm_utils_hwaddr_ntoa().

Found by pavlix in NM live VM.
parent 841c2591
......@@ -73,7 +73,7 @@ char *
nm_config_device_get_hwaddr (NMConfigDevice *self)
{
const guint8 *bytes;
guint len;
guint len = 0;
bytes = NM_CONFIG_DEVICE_GET_INTERFACE (self)->get_hw_address (self, &len);
return nm_utils_hwaddr_ntoa (bytes, nm_utils_hwaddr_type (len));
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ment